Drug courier caught with £700 of heroin

A FILEY drug courier caught transporting £700 worth of heroin across the Pennines has been jailed for 15 months.

Martin Edward Hardwick, 39, who admitted making a similar trip twice before without being caught, was sentenced at York Crown Court for possessing a Class A drug with intent to supply.

The court heard he had been driving dozens of cling film wraps of the drug between Manchester and Scarborough when he was stopped by police on the A64 Malton bypass last November.

Police officers noticed Hardwick, of Belle Vue Street, drop a cigarette packet from the driver's door and kick it behind a wheel on his car.

When recovered, the packet contained 57 cling film wraps of heroin, which Hardwick initially denied had anything to do with him.

Bashir Ahmed, prosecuting, said the defendant finally admitted having picked up the drugs from someone in a lay-by in the Manchester area and was being employed to transport it to others in Scarborough who would then have sold it on the streets.

He told the police he had done the trip twice before.

Ian Brook, mitigating, said his client, who has previous convictions for driving with excess alcohol, possession of an offensive weapon and having a bladed item in a public place, was easily led.

He added that Hardwick, himself an addict and unemployed, carried out the latest offence in return for heroin for his own use. The court heard he had returned to drug abuse after his partner and their children moved out 18 months ago.

Mr Brook said custody would prove especially hard for his client because he suffers from claustrophobia.

Jailing Hardwick for 15 months, Judge Robert Bartfield told him that although he accepted he was a "rather meek" person with some mental health problems, the offence was too serious not to attract a custodial sentence.
